The Descendants is not a bad movie by any stretch of the imagination but it certainly wasn’t a movie for me.

Yes, I knew it was going to be a family drama going into it and I am glad that I saw it because it has confirmed that I am just not interested in watching any more films about the struggle of one man trying to keep his family together while overcoming odds and through the ordeal manages to make his bond with his daughters even stronger.

Summary:

The movie’s title, “The Ides of March” refers to a specific date, March 15, which is the day upon which the events of this film focus. In this story, March 15 is the date of the Ohio Primary, when Governor Mike Morris (George Clooney) hopes to vanquish his opponent and claim the Democratic nomination allowing him to run for the presidential seat.

In his camp are his campaign manager, Paul (Philip Seymour Hoffman), and his chief strategist, Stephen (Ryan Gosling). Stephen is a man at the height of his powers despite his youth. Stephen’s talents are coveted by his opponent, namely Duffy (Paul Giamatti). As with any political contest especially one run in the convoluted American system; this is not all about winning the race for Ohio.
